Is the
Green Deal a fair deal for SMEs?
The Green Deal is widely accepted as a progressive idea in principle. But, says Conor McGlone, criticism that the way the scheme has been designed could exclude small and medium sized businesses is damaging its credibility
Finally launched in January, the Government’s highly anticipated retrofit energy-efficiency scheme has been posi- tioned as a key mechanism in reaching its target of reducing UK greenhouse gas
emissions by 80% by 2050. However, already the scheme has been mired in accusations that it has been under-pub- licised, the interest rates are far too high and the process is overly complex, par-
ticularly for SMEs.
